在快节奏的现代社会,信息过载成为了一个普遍问题。微信作为国内最受欢迎的社交平台之一,其公众号推荐功能无疑为我们节省了大量筛选信息的时间。那么,微信是如何精准推荐公众号的呢?本文将揭开这一神秘面纱,带你了解背后的算法逻辑。
算法基础:用户画像
微信推荐公众号的核心在于构建用户画像。用户画像是指通过对用户在微信平台上的行为、兴趣、习惯等进行综合分析,形成的关于用户的一个全面描述。以下是构建用户画像的几个关键因素:
- 用户行为数据:包括用户在微信上的浏览记录、点赞、评论、转发等行为。
- 用户兴趣标签:根据用户浏览过的内容、关注过的公众号、朋友圈分享等,为用户贴上相应的兴趣标签。
- 社交关系:分析用户的微信好友、群聊等社交关系,了解用户在社交圈中的活跃度和影响力。
推荐算法:深度学习与机器学习
微信推荐公众号的算法主要基于深度学习和机器学习技术。以下是几种常见的推荐算法:
- 协同过滤:通过分析用户之间的相似度,为用户推荐相似用户喜欢的公众号。
- 内容推荐:根据用户兴趣标签,为用户推荐相关内容的公众号。
- 混合推荐:结合协同过滤和内容推荐,为用户推荐更精准的公众号。
精准推荐的关键
- 个性化推荐:根据用户画像,为不同用户推荐不同的公众号,提高推荐效果。
- 实时更新:根据用户行为的变化,实时调整推荐策略,确保推荐内容与用户兴趣保持一致。
- 数据安全:在推荐过程中,保护用户隐私和数据安全,确保用户信息安全。
实例分析
以一位喜欢阅读科技类文章的用户为例,以下是微信推荐公众号的过程:
- 用户画像构建:根据用户浏览记录、兴趣标签等,将用户划分为科技爱好者。
- 推荐算法:结合协同过滤和内容推荐,为用户推荐科技类公众号。
- 实时更新:当用户阅读一篇关于人工智能的文章时,推荐算法会实时调整,为用户推荐更多相关内容。
总结
微信推荐公众号背后的秘密在于构建用户画像和运用先进的推荐算法。通过个性化推荐、实时更新和数据安全保护,微信为用户提供了精准、高效的公众号推荐服务。未来,随着技术的不断发展,微信推荐公众号的精准度将越来越高,为用户带来更好的阅读体验。
